As part of Utah Native Plant Month, the Intermountain Native Plant Growers Association has launched its Garden of the Month neighborhood garden. For additional information on this and other programs log on to www.utahschoice.org.
The Jordan Valley Water Conservancy District Garden Fair is Saturday, 8 a.m.-2 p.m., at the Conservation Garden Park, 8215 S. 1300 West, West Jordan. The fair will include free classes on designing with Utah native and water-wise design. For more information, call 877-728-3420 or log on to www.slowtheflow.org.
Red Butte Garden is hosting a workshop on herbs Saturday, 10 a.m.-noon. Regular garden admission applies; members get in free. No registration is required. For more information, log on to www.redbuttegarden.org.
